- Associate Head Coach
Description
Assist the Head Coach in the development and implementation of training systems, athlete development, and coaching consistency across the HVA Current program. Lead assigned practice groups, support seasonal and daily training design, teach stroke technique, and help swimmers progress through age-appropriate development pathways aligned with long-term athlete development principles.
The ideal candidate will demonstrate an understanding of the USA Swimming American Development Model, modern training methodologies, and progressive athlete development systems. Candidates should also possess demonstrated ability to prepare and support swimmers competing at the Futures level and above.
The Assistant Head Coach will support meet preparation and operations, mentor developing coaches, and contribute to a positive and professional coaching culture. This position is designed as a leadership development role with the opportunity to grow into a Head Coach position within the program over time.
